My dad has been here for a few months. It looks nice and modern, however the quality of care is concerning. He's been dressed in women's clothing, sitting in soiled pants without any under garments, and has "lost" multiple items. They corral all of the residents in the dining hall and do nothing all day. There's not even the illusion of something to do. They sit at tables staring at each other; there's no interaction or stimulation. We'll get him out of there as soon as we can. He HATES it, and has declined significantly since he's entered.

Windmill Nursing Pavilion was the Worst experience I ever witnessed. I went there for 20 days care after a knee replacement. Staff was terrible, convenience for getting food and medicine was on a get it yourself basis via your wheelchair. No telephone in room for patients and patients were ignored when asked to use the desk operator telephone. Water was not served in rooms. Towels and washcloths were not furnished when requested. Physical Therapy was the only thing that would pass a test. I survived because each day I expected it to get better, but it never did.
